#62d0d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62d0d5 is composed of 38.4% red, 81.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 61%. #62d0d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00a1ab.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#62d0d5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#62d0d5 has RGB values of R:98, G:208,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6475989.

Hex triplet 62d0d5 #62d0d5
RGB Decimal 98, 208, 213 rgb(98,208,213)
RGB Percent 38.4, 81.6, 83.5 rgb(38.4%,81.6%,83.5%)
CMYK 54, 2, 0, 16
HSL 182.6°, 57.8, 61 hsl(182.6,57.8%,61%)
HSV (or HSB) 182.6°, 54, 83.5
Web Safe 66cccc #66cccc
CIE-LAB 77.585, -29.941, -12.076
XYZ 39.6, 52.51, 70.996
xyY 0.243, 0.322, 52.51
CIE-LCH 77.585, 32.285, 201.965
CIE-LUV 77.585, -45.959, -14.148
Hunter-Lab 72.464, -29.265, -7.365
Binary 01100010, 11010000, 11010101

Shades and Tints of #62d0d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d0d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#62d0d5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989f9f is the less saturated color, while #3cf3fb is the most saturated one.
